Investopedia Stock Simulator

Investopedia’s Stock Simulator is one of the most popular and highly-regarded stock market games available. With a virtual $100,000 to start, you can practice buying and selling stocks, options, and other securities in a realistic and interactive environment. The simulator offers real-time market data, allowing you to react to actual market events and make informed investment decisions. Additionally, Investopedia provides a wealth of educational resources and tutorials to help you improve your investing knowledge and skills.

What are stock market games and simulations?
+Stock market games and simulations are online platforms that allow users to practice investing and trading in a virtual environment, using real-time market data and news feeds.
What are the benefits of using stock market games and simulations?
+The benefits of using stock market games and simulations include improved investing skills and knowledge, a risk-free environment to practice and learn, and access to educational resources and tools.
